1. A method for detecting physiological coherence in an animal subject comprising the acts of:

  • sampling a physiological measure of the animal subject;

    deriving a power spectrum distribution (PSD) from the physiological measure;

    tracking dynamically a PSD peak within a predetermined range where the PSD peak has a relative amplitude to a plurality of other peaks in the PSD;

    determining a current coherence value based on said relative amplitude and corresponding to the animal subject'"'"'s automatic nervous system (ANS) activity;

    determining, by a processor, a current coherence category for the animal subject from a plurality of coherence categories which correspond to the current coherence value; and

    providing a coherence category indication associated with the current coherence category.
